Witrynacommodities to New Zealand without negotiation or preapproval by MPI. i) Marine fish products from Australia (IHS clause 2.2.1) ii) Low-risk non-salmonid fish products from any country (IHS clause 2.2.3) iii) Non-salmonid fish products from any country for further processing in New Zealand (IHS clause 2.2.4) Chiton glaucus, common name the green chiton or the blue green chiton, is a species of chiton, a marine polyplacophoran mollusk in the family Chitonidae, the typical chitons. It is the most common chiton species in New Zealand. Chiton glaucus is part of a very primitive group of mollusc with evidence of being present in up to 80 million years of the fossil record.
